About This Item

New York: Scholastic, Inc, 1994. Hardcover. Very Good/No Jacket. 4to - over 9?" - 12" tall. Guido Maestro. Type: Hardback Scholastic, Inc. nature book for young readers in Near Fine Condition. Laminated cover illustrated with the ' night fliers' --clean and bright, just a touch of wear to lower front corner and spine head. Beautifully illusrated by Guido Maeston. The structure, life cyycle, and natural history of bats; some interesting facts about bats and different kinds of bats--and really well illustrated. Internals As New. 32 pages. 4to - over 9?" - 12" Tall. 1994, Scholastic, Inc., NY.
